How to Pick Out a Replacement Seal for a Surplus Military Axle  

Question:

I have an old trailer with an inner bearing 24780 TIMKEN. It may be a surplus military axle. What bearing seal should I use for it? Thanks-

0

Expert Reply:

In order to pick out a grease seal to match the hubs of your military axle you are going to need to remove the hub from your spindle and using a dial caliper or micrometer get the exact diameter of the spindle where the seal rides and then get the exact inner diameter of the hub bore where your seal fits in the hub.

The spindle measurement will be the inner diameter needed for your replacement seal, the inner diameter of the hub will be the outer diameter of the seal you need.
